The Last Race Report: Josh Amberger Reflects on his Pro Career
Q: What influenced your decision to shift from short‑distance to longer formats and eventually Ironman‑style racing?
He explains the fatigue with purely draft‑legal racing, the appeal of the non‑drafting, time‑trial feel of middle distances, and learning to balance speed with endurance, leading to a long, sustainable career.
Vietnam on Two Wheels: Inside the 4,000km Journey of InnerScape
Q: What would be your advice in terms of preparation before they even arrive at the start line?
Olivier recommends preparing for the heat, adapting to riding covered to protect from the sun, and being mentally ready for the remote sections of the race in Vietnam.
Vietnam on Two Wheels: Inside the 4,000km Journey of InnerScape
Q: How safe is it for a woman there riding alone?
Olivier notes that he has not heard any discussions of female riders feeling unsafe in Vietnam and shares that as a male, he has also felt safe during his encounters with locals.
Vietnam on Two Wheels: Inside the 4,000km Journey of InnerScape
Q: Why did you choose the north to south path for the race?
Olivier highlights the historical significance of the north to south route as it follows Vietnam's origin and modern reunification, providing a reflective journey for riders through the country's landscapes and history.
Vietnam on Two Wheels: Inside the 4,000km Journey of InnerScape
Q: What motivated you to turn this vision into a reality?
Olivier shares his long-standing connection to Asia and specifically Vietnam, explaining how personal reasons, such as family ties and experiences during COVID, inspired him to create the race.

Frequently Asked Questions About Zone2Speak Podcast

What is Zone2Speak Podcast about and what kind of topics does it cover?

Zone2Speak covers a wide range of cycling topics, from ultra-endurance adventures and women's cycling empowerment to cycling wellness, coaching, and gear. Episodes frequently feature athletes, coaches, photographers, and entrepreneurs who share hard-won tips, personal journeys, and industry insights. The show often highlights practical preparation for long-distance rides, injury prevention, and the culture and community surrounding cycling, with a special emphasis on inclusivity, women in the sport, and adventurous travel. A notable strength is its ability to blend actionable advice with human stories, making it helpful for listeners seeking inspiration, training ideas, and behind-the-scenes perspectives on cycling events and brands.
